  1. // Copyright 2016 - 2019 The excelize Authors. All rights reserved. Use of
  2. // this source code is governed by a BSD-style license that can be found in
  3. // the LICENSE file.
  4. //
  5. // Package excelize providing a set of functions that allow you to write to
  6. // and read from XLSX files. Support reads and writes XLSX file generated by
  7. // Microsoft Excel™ 2007 and later. Support save file without losing original
  8. // charts of XLSX. This library needs Go version 1.10 or later.
  9. package excelize
  10. import "encoding/xml"
  11. // Source relationship and namespace.
  12. const (
  13. SourceRelationship = "http://schemas.openxmlformats.org/officeDocument/2006/relationships"
  14. SourceRelationshipChart =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/chart"
  15. SourceRelationshipComments =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/comments"
  16. SourceRelationshipImage =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/image"
  17. SourceRelationshipTable =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/table"
  18. SourceRelationshipDrawingML =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/drawing"
  19. SourceRelationshipDrawingVML =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/vmlDrawing"
  20. SourceRelationshipHyperLink =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/hyperlink"
  21. SourceRelationshipWorkSheet = "http://schemas.openxmlformats.org/officeDocument/2006/relationships/worksheet"
  22. SourceRelationshipVBAProject = "http://schemas.microsoft.com/office/2006/relationships/vbaProject"
  23. SourceRelationshipChart201506 = "http://schemas.microsoft.com/office/drawing/2015/06/chart"
  24. SourceRelationshipChart20070802 = "http://schemas.microsoft.com/office/drawing/2007/8/2/chart"
  25. SourceRelationshipChart2014 = "http://schemas.microsoft.com/office/drawing/2014/chart"
  26. SourceRelationshipCompatibility = "http://schemas.openxmlformats.org/markup-compatibility/2006"
  27. NameSpaceDrawingML = "http://schemas.openxmlformats.org/drawingml/2006/main"
  28. NameSpaceDrawingMLChart = "http://schemas.openxmlformats.org/drawingml/2006/chart"
  29. NameSpaceDrawingMLSpreadSheet = "http://schemas.openxmlformats.org/drawingml/2006/spreadsheetDrawing"
  30. NameSpaceSpreadSheet = "http://schemas.openxmlformats.org/spreadsheetml/2006/main"
  31. NameSpaceSpreadSheetX14 = "http://schemas.microsoft.com/office/spreadsheetml/2009/9/main"
  32. NameSpaceSpreadSheetX15 = "http://schemas.microsoft.com/office/spreadsheetml/2010/11/main"
  33. NameSpaceSpreadSheetExcel2006Main = "http://schemas.microsoft.com/office/excel/2006/main"
  34. NameSpaceMacExcel2008Main = "http://schemas.microsoft.com/office/mac/excel/2008/main"
  35. NameSpaceXML = "http://www.w3.org/XML/1998/namespace"
  36. NameSpaceXMLSchemaInstance = "http://www.w3.org/2001/XMLSchema-instance"
  37. StrictSourceRelationship = "http://purl.oclc.org/ooxml/officeDocument/relationships"
  38. StrictSourceRelationshipChart = "http://purl.oclc.org/ooxml/officeDocument/relationships/chart"
  39. StrictSourceRelationshipComments = "http://purl.oclc.org/ooxml/officeDocument/relationships/comments"
  40. StrictSourceRelationshipImage = "http://purl.oclc.org/ooxml/officeDocument/relationships/image"
  41. StrictNameSpaceSpreadSheet = "http://purl.oclc.org/ooxml/spreadsheetml/main"
  42. NameSpaceDublinCore = "http://purl.org/dc/elements/1.1/"
  43. NameSpaceDublinCoreTerms = "http://purl.org/dc/terms/"
  44. NameSpaceDublinCoreMetadataIntiative = "http://purl.org/dc/dcmitype/"
  45. // The extLst child element ([ISO/IEC29500-1:2016] section 18.2.10) of the
  46. // worksheet element ([ISO/IEC29500-1:2016] section 18.3.1.99) is extended by
  47. // the addition of new child ext elements ([ISO/IEC29500-1:2016] section
  48. // 18.2.7)
  49. ExtURIConditionalFormattings = "{78C0D931-6437-407D-A8EE-F0AAD7539E65}"
  50. ExtURIDataValidations = "{CCE6A557-97BC-4B89-ADB6-D9C93CAAB3DF}"
  51. ExtURISparklineGroups = "{05C60535-1F16-4fd2-B633-F4F36F0B64E0}"
  52. ExtURISlicerListX14 = "{A8765BA9-456A-4DAB-B4F3-ACF838C121DE}"
  53. ExtURISlicerCachesListX14 = "{BBE1A952-AA13-448e-AADC-164F8A28A991}"
  54. ExtURISlicerListX15 = "{3A4CF648-6AED-40f4-86FF-DC5316D8AED3}"
  55. ExtURIProtectedRanges = "{FC87AEE6-9EDD-4A0A-B7FB-166176984837}"
  56. ExtURIIgnoredErrors = "{01252117-D84E-4E92-8308-4BE1C098FCBB}"
  57. ExtURIWebExtensions = "{F7C9EE02-42E1-4005-9D12-6889AFFD525C}"
  58. ExtURITimelineRefs = "{7E03D99C-DC04-49d9-9315-930204A7B6E9}"
  59. ExtURIDrawingBlip = "{28A0092B-C50C-407E-A947-70E740481C1C}"
  60. ExtURIMacExcelMX = "{64002731-A6B0-56B0-2670-7721B7C09600}"
  61. )
  62. var supportImageTypes = map[string]string{".gif": ".gif", ".jpg": ".jpeg", ".jpeg": ".jpeg", ".png": ".png", ".tif": ".tiff", ".tiff": ".tiff"}
  63. // xlsxCNvPr directly maps the cNvPr (Non-Visual Drawing Properties). This
  64. // element specifies non-visual canvas properties. This allows for additional
  65. // information that does not affect the appearance of the picture to be stored.
  66. type xlsxCNvPr struct {
  67. ID int `xml:"id,attr"`
  68. Name string `xml:"name,attr"`
  69. Descr string `xml:"descr,attr"`
  70. Title string `xml:"title,attr,omitempty"`
  71. HlinkClick *xlsxHlinkClick `xml:"a:hlinkClick"`
  72. }
  73. // xlsxHlinkClick (Click Hyperlink) Specifies the on-click hyperlink
  74. // information to be applied to a run of text. When the hyperlink text is
  75. // clicked the link is fetched.
  76. type xlsxHlinkClick struct {
  77. R string `xml:"xmlns:r,attr,omitempty"`
  78. RID string `xml:"r:id,attr,omitempty"`
  79. InvalidURL string `xml:"invalidUrl,attr,omitempty"`
  80. Action string `xml:"action,attr,omitempty"`
  81. TgtFrame string `xml:"tgtFrame,attr,omitempty"`
  82. Tooltip string `xml:"tooltip,attr,omitempty"`
  83. History bool `xml:"history,attr,omitempty"`
  84. HighlightClick bool `xml:"highlightClick,attr,omitempty"`
  85. EndSnd bool `xml:"endSnd,attr,omitempty"`
  86. }
  87. // xlsxPicLocks directly maps the picLocks (Picture Locks). This element
  88. // specifies all locking properties for a graphic frame. These properties inform
  89. // the generating application about specific properties that have been
  90. // previously locked and thus should not be changed.
  91. type xlsxPicLocks struct {
  92. NoAdjustHandles bool `xml:"noAdjustHandles,attr,omitempty"`
  93. NoChangeArrowheads bool `xml:"noChangeArrowheads,attr,omitempty"`
  94. NoChangeAspect bool `xml:"noChangeAspect,attr"`
  95. NoChangeShapeType bool `xml:"noChangeShapeType,attr,omitempty"`
  96. NoCrop bool `xml:"noCrop,attr,omitempty"`
  97. NoEditPoints bool `xml:"noEditPoints,attr,omitempty"`
  98. NoGrp bool `xml:"noGrp,attr,omitempty"`
  99. NoMove bool `xml:"noMove,attr,omitempty"`
  100. NoResize bool `xml:"noResize,attr,omitempty"`
  101. NoRot bool `xml:"noRot,attr,omitempty"`
  102. NoSelect bool `xml:"noSelect,attr,omitempty"`
  103. }
  104. // xlsxBlip directly maps the blip element in the namespace
  105. // http://purl.oclc.org/ooxml/officeDoc ument/relationships - This element
  106. // specifies the existence of an image (binary large image or picture) and
  107. // contains a reference to the image data.
  108. type xlsxBlip struct {
  109. Embed string `xml:"r:embed,attr"`
  110. Cstate string `xml:"cstate,attr,omitempty"`
  111. R string `xml:"xmlns:r,attr"`
  112. }
  113. // xlsxStretch directly maps the stretch element. This element specifies that a
  114. // BLIP should be stretched to fill the target rectangle. The other option is a
  115. // tile where a BLIP is tiled to fill the available area.
  116. type xlsxStretch struct {
  117. FillRect string `xml:"a:fillRect"`
  118. }
  119. // xlsxOff directly maps the colOff and rowOff element. This element is used to
  120. // specify the column offset within a cell.
  121. type xlsxOff struct {
  122. X int `xml:"x,attr"`
  123. Y int `xml:"y,attr"`
  124. }
  125. // xlsxExt directly maps the ext element.
  126. type xlsxExt struct {
  127. Cx int `xml:"cx,attr"`
  128. Cy int `xml:"cy,attr"`
  129. }
  130. // xlsxPrstGeom directly maps the prstGeom (Preset geometry). This element
  131. // specifies when a preset geometric shape should be used instead of a custom
  132. // geometric shape. The generating application should be able to render all
  133. // preset geometries enumerated in the ST_ShapeType list.
  134. type xlsxPrstGeom struct {
  135. Prst string `xml:"prst,attr"`
  136. }
  137. // xlsxXfrm directly maps the xfrm (2D Transform for Graphic Frame). This
  138. // element specifies the transform to be applied to the corresponding graphic
  139. // frame. This transformation is applied to the graphic frame just as it would
  140. // be for a shape or group shape.
  141. type xlsxXfrm struct {
  142. Off xlsxOff `xml:"a:off"`
  143. Ext xlsxExt `xml:"a:ext"`
  144. }
  145. // xlsxCNvPicPr directly maps the cNvPicPr (Non-Visual Picture Drawing
  146. // Properties). This element specifies the non-visual properties for the picture
  147. // canvas. These properties are to be used by the generating application to
  148. // determine how certain properties are to be changed for the picture object in
  149. // question.
  150. type xlsxCNvPicPr struct {
  151. PicLocks xlsxPicLocks `xml:"a:picLocks"`
  152. }
  153. // directly maps the nvPicPr (Non-Visual Properties for a Picture). This element
  154. // specifies all non-visual properties for a picture. This element is a
  155. // container for the non-visual identification properties, shape properties and
  156. // application properties that are to be associated with a picture. This allows
  157. // for additional information that does not affect the appearance of the picture
  158. // to be stored.
  159. type xlsxNvPicPr struct {
  160. CNvPr xlsxCNvPr `xml:"xdr:cNvPr"`
  161. CNvPicPr xlsxCNvPicPr `xml:"xdr:cNvPicPr"`
  162. }
  163. // xlsxBlipFill directly maps the blipFill (Picture Fill). This element
  164. // specifies the kind of picture fill that the picture object has. Because a
  165. // picture has a picture fill already by default, it is possible to have two
  166. // fills specified for a picture object.
  167. type xlsxBlipFill struct {
  168. Blip xlsxBlip `xml:"a:blip"`
  169. Stretch xlsxStretch `xml:"a:stretch"`
  170. }
  171. // xlsxSpPr directly maps the spPr (Shape Properties). This element specifies
  172. // the visual shape properties that can be applied to a picture. These are the
  173. // same properties that are allowed to describe the visual properties of a shape
  174. // but are used here to describe the visual appearance of a picture within a
  175. // document.
  176. type xlsxSpPr struct {
  177. Xfrm xlsxXfrm `xml:"a:xfrm"`
  178. PrstGeom xlsxPrstGeom `xml:"a:prstGeom"`
  179. }
  180. // xlsxPic elements encompass the definition of pictures within the DrawingML
  181. // framework. While pictures are in many ways very similar to shapes they have
  182. // specific properties that are unique in order to optimize for picture-
  183. // specific scenarios.
  184. type xlsxPic struct {
  185. NvPicPr xlsxNvPicPr `xml:"xdr:nvPicPr"`
  186. BlipFill xlsxBlipFill `xml:"xdr:blipFill"`
  187. SpPr xlsxSpPr `xml:"xdr:spPr"`
  188. }
  189. // xlsxFrom specifies the starting anchor.
  190. type xlsxFrom struct {
  191. Col int `xml:"xdr:col"`
  192. ColOff int `xml:"xdr:colOff"`
  193. Row int `xml:"xdr:row"`
  194. RowOff int `xml:"xdr:rowOff"`
  195. }
  196. // xlsxTo directly specifies the ending anchor.
  197. type xlsxTo struct {
  198. Col int `xml:"xdr:col"`
  199. ColOff int `xml:"xdr:colOff"`
  200. Row int `xml:"xdr:row"`
  201. RowOff int `xml:"xdr:rowOff"`
  202. }
  203. // xdrClientData directly maps the clientData element. An empty element which
  204. // specifies (via attributes) certain properties related to printing and
  205. // selection of the drawing object. The fLocksWithSheet attribute (either true
  206. // or false) determines whether to disable selection when the sheet is
  207. // protected, and fPrintsWithSheet attribute (either true or false) determines
  208. // whether the object is printed when the sheet is printed.
  209. type xdrClientData struct {
  210. FLocksWithSheet bool `xml:"fLocksWithSheet,attr"`
  211. FPrintsWithSheet bool `xml:"fPrintsWithSheet,attr"`
  212. }
  213. // xdrCellAnchor directly maps the oneCellAnchor (One Cell Anchor Shape Size)
  214. // and twoCellAnchor (Two Cell Anchor Shape Size). This element specifies a two
  215. // cell anchor placeholder for a group, a shape, or a drawing element. It moves
  216. // with cells and its extents are in EMU units.
  217. type xdrCellAnchor struct {
  218. EditAs string `xml:"editAs,attr,omitempty"`
  219. From *xlsxFrom `xml:"xdr:from"`
  220. To *xlsxTo `xml:"xdr:to"`
  221. Ext *xlsxExt `xml:"xdr:ext"`
  222. Sp *xdrSp `xml:"xdr:sp"`
  223. Pic *xlsxPic `xml:"xdr:pic,omitempty"`
  224. GraphicFrame string `xml:",innerxml"`
  225. ClientData *xdrClientData `xml:"xdr:clientData"`
  226. }
  227. // xlsxWsDr directly maps the root element for a part of this content type shall
  228. // wsDr.
  229. type xlsxWsDr struct {
  230. XMLName xml.Name `xml:"xdr:wsDr"`
  231. OneCellAnchor []*xdrCellAnchor `xml:"xdr:oneCellAnchor"`
  232. TwoCellAnchor []*xdrCellAnchor `xml:"xdr:twoCellAnchor"`
  233. A string `xml:"xmlns:a,attr,omitempty"`
  234. Xdr string `xml:"xmlns:xdr,attr,omitempty"`
  235. R string `xml:"xmlns:r,attr,omitempty"`
  236. }
  237. // xlsxGraphicFrame (Graphic Frame) directly maps the xdr:graphicFrame element.
  238. // This element specifies the existence of a graphics frame. This frame contains
  239. // a graphic that was generated by an external source and needs a container in
  240. // which to be displayed on the slide surface.
  241. type xlsxGraphicFrame struct {
  242. XMLName xml.Name `xml:"xdr:graphicFrame"`
  243. Macro string `xml:"macro,attr"`
  244. NvGraphicFramePr xlsxNvGraphicFramePr `xml:"xdr:nvGraphicFramePr"`
  245. Xfrm xlsxXfrm `xml:"xdr:xfrm"`
  246. Graphic *xlsxGraphic `xml:"a:graphic"`
  247. }
  248. // xlsxNvGraphicFramePr (Non-Visual Properties for a Graphic Frame) directly
  249. // maps the xdr:nvGraphicFramePr element. This element specifies all non-visual
  250. // properties for a graphic frame. This element is a container for the non-
  251. // visual identification properties, shape properties and application properties
  252. // that are to be associated with a graphic frame. This allows for additional
  253. // information that does not affect the appearance of the graphic frame to be
  254. // stored.
  255. type xlsxNvGraphicFramePr struct {
  256. CNvPr *xlsxCNvPr `xml:"xdr:cNvPr"`
  257. ChicNvGraphicFramePr string `xml:"xdr:cNvGraphicFramePr"`
  258. }
  259. // xlsxGraphic (Graphic Object) directly maps the a:graphic element. This
  260. // element specifies the existence of a single graphic object. Document authors
  261. // should refer to this element when they wish to persist a graphical object of
  262. // some kind. The specification for this graphical object is provided entirely
  263. // by the document author and referenced within the graphicData child element.
  264. type xlsxGraphic struct {
  265. GraphicData *xlsxGraphicData `xml:"a:graphicData"`
  266. }
  267. // xlsxGraphicData (Graphic Object Data) directly maps the a:graphicData
  268. // element. This element specifies the reference to a graphic object within the
  269. // document. This graphic object is provided entirely by the document authors
  270. // who choose to persist this data within the document.
  271. type xlsxGraphicData struct {
  272. URI string `xml:"uri,attr"`
  273. Chart *xlsxChart `xml:"c:chart,omitempty"`
  274. }
  275. // xlsxChart (Chart) directly maps the c:chart element.
  276. type xlsxChart struct {
  277. C string `xml:"xmlns:c,attr"`
  278. RID string `xml:"r:id,attr"`
  279. R string `xml:"xmlns:r,attr"`
  280. }
  281. // xdrSp (Shape) directly maps the xdr:sp element. This element specifies the
  282. // existence of a single shape. A shape can either be a preset or a custom
  283. // geometry, defined using the SpreadsheetDrawingML framework. In addition to a
  284. // geometry each shape can have both visual and non-visual properties attached.
  285. // Text and corresponding styling information can also be attached to a shape.
  286. // This shape is specified along with all other shapes within either the shape
  287. // tree or group shape elements.
  288. type xdrSp struct {
  289. Macro string `xml:"macro,attr"`
  290. Textlink string `xml:"textlink,attr"`
  291. NvSpPr *xdrNvSpPr `xml:"xdr:nvSpPr"`
  292. SpPr *xlsxSpPr `xml:"xdr:spPr"`
  293. Style *xdrStyle `xml:"xdr:style"`
  294. TxBody *xdrTxBody `xml:"xdr:txBody"`
  295. }
  296. // xdrNvSpPr (Non-Visual Properties for a Shape) directly maps the xdr:nvSpPr
  297. // element. This element specifies all non-visual properties for a shape. This
  298. // element is a container for the non-visual identification properties, shape
  299. // properties and application properties that are to be associated with a shape.
  300. // This allows for additional information that does not affect the appearance of
  301. // the shape to be stored.
  302. type xdrNvSpPr struct {
  303. CNvPr *xlsxCNvPr `xml:"xdr:cNvPr"`
  304. CNvSpPr *xdrCNvSpPr `xml:"xdr:cNvSpPr"`
  305. }
  306. // xdrCNvSpPr (Connection Non-Visual Shape Properties) directly maps the
  307. // xdr:cNvSpPr element. This element specifies the set of non-visual properties
  308. // for a connection shape. These properties specify all data about the
  309. // connection shape which do not affect its display within a spreadsheet.
  310. type xdrCNvSpPr struct {
  311. TxBox bool `xml:"txBox,attr"`
  312. }
  313. // xdrStyle (Shape Style) directly maps the xdr:style element. The element
  314. // specifies the style that is applied to a shape and the corresponding
  315. // references for each of the style components such as lines and fills.
  316. type xdrStyle struct {
  317. LnRef *aRef `xml:"a:lnRef"`
  318. FillRef *aRef `xml:"a:fillRef"`
  319. EffectRef *aRef `xml:"a:effectRef"`
  320. FontRef *aFontRef `xml:"a:fontRef"`
  321. }
  322. // aRef directly maps the a:lnRef, a:fillRef and a:effectRef element.
  323. type aRef struct {
  324. Idx int `xml:"idx,attr"`
  325. ScrgbClr *aScrgbClr `xml:"a:scrgbClr"`
  326. SchemeClr *attrValString `xml:"a:schemeClr"`
  327. SrgbClr *attrValString `xml:"a:srgbClr"`
  328. }
  329. // aScrgbClr (RGB Color Model - Percentage Variant) directly maps the a:scrgbClr
  330. // element. This element specifies a color using the red, green, blue RGB color
  331. // model. Each component, red, green, and blue is expressed as a percentage from
  332. // 0% to 100%. A linear gamma of 1.0 is assumed.
  333. type aScrgbClr struct {
  334. R float64 `xml:"r,attr"`
  335. G float64 `xml:"g,attr"`
  336. B float64 `xml:"b,attr"`
  337. }
  338. // aFontRef (Font Reference) directly maps the a:fontRef element. This element
  339. // represents a reference to a themed font. When used it specifies which themed
  340. // font to use along with a choice of color.
  341. type aFontRef struct {
  342. Idx string `xml:"idx,attr"`
  343. SchemeClr *attrValString `xml:"a:schemeClr"`
  344. }
  345. // xdrTxBody (Shape Text Body) directly maps the xdr:txBody element. This
  346. // element specifies the existence of text to be contained within the
  347. // corresponding shape. All visible text and visible text related properties are
  348. // contained within this element. There can be multiple paragraphs and within
  349. // paragraphs multiple runs of text.
  350. type xdrTxBody struct {
  351. BodyPr *aBodyPr `xml:"a:bodyPr"`
  352. P []*aP `xml:"a:p"`
  353. }
  354. // formatPicture directly maps the format settings of the picture.
  355. type formatPicture struct {
  356. FPrintsWithSheet bool `json:"print_obj"`
  357. FLocksWithSheet bool `json:"locked"`
  358. NoChangeAspect bool `json:"lock_aspect_ratio"`
  359. OffsetX int `json:"x_offset"`
  360. OffsetY int `json:"y_offset"`
  361. XScale float64 `json:"x_scale"`
  362. YScale float64 `json:"y_scale"`
  363. Hyperlink string `json:"hyperlink"`
  364. HyperlinkType string `json:"hyperlink_type"`
  365. Positioning string `json:"positioning"`
  366. }
  367. // formatShape directly maps the format settings of the shape.
  368. type formatShape struct {
  369. Type string `json:"type"`
  370. Width int `json:"width"`
  371. Height int `json:"height"`
  372. Format formatPicture `json:"format"`
  373. Color formatShapeColor `json:"color"`
  374. Paragraph []formatShapeParagraph `json:"paragraph"`
  375. }
  376. // formatShapeParagraph directly maps the format settings of the paragraph in
  377. // the shape.
  378. type formatShapeParagraph struct {
  379. Font formatFont `json:"font"`
  380. Text string `json:"text"`
  381. }
  382. // formatShapeColor directly maps the color settings of the shape.
  383. type formatShapeColor struct {
  384. Line string `json:"line"`
  385. Fill string `json:"fill"`
  386. Effect string `json:"effect"`
